Transaction 37fd65cbe99f1359ef3bd5ffd530de8eafa39d977ebe004a44647ee787368f76
1 Input
1 Output
-
37fd65cbe99f1359ef3bd5ffd530de8eafa39d977ebe004a44647ee787368f76:0
- value
- 676432
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8b705918e5bf33205cdfe61835e0538a56e71a7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LktD1ZUeLgUQgH2eos4B2gvWgkcxmEQtC